Michigan Tech women climb 2 spots to No. 13

LILBURN, Ga. – The Michigan Tech women’s basketball team moved up two spots to No. 13 in the latest Women’s Basketball Coaches Association NCAA Division II Top 25 Coaches’ Poll, announced Thursday by the national office.

The Huskies were ranked 21st in the preseason poll, moved up to 10th in the first regular season rankings and held the No. 18 ranking for two weeks prior to jumping up to No. 15 in last week’s rankings.

The Huskies extended their winning streak to six games this past Sunday when they defeated Great Lakes Intercollegiate Athletic Conference rival Northern Michigan 59-56 on the road.

Tech outscored the Wildcats 14-8 in the third quarter to move in front and then held off NMU in the final minute to secure the win. The victory improved the Huskies’ overall record to 11-1 and 5-0 in the GLIAC as they head into the holiday break.

Michigan Tech earned 282 points in this week’s poll and remain as one of two GLIAC teams ranked in the top 25.

Ashland was also unbeaten last week and stays in the No. 1 spot with 575 points and all 23 first place votes. Grand Valley State is also just outside the top 25 again this week with a spot in the receiving votes category.

The Huskies are off until after the holidays when they return home to face top-ranked and defending national champion Ashland in the SDC on Thursday January 4th. The tip-off is scheduled for 5:30 p.m.
